For our boat:
Lighthouse windlass.
Ketten Walder 10mm stainless chain
Ultra 45 kg anchor
(There goes the Christmas bonus...)
The Professional Navigator got very excited on the Mailasail stand. The conversation went clean over my head and I must ask him to explain it to me but the Red Box is apparently something I want. On the same stand the charming lady from the OCC asked me to sign the visitors book for Club members but the last signature on it was Jeanne Socrates (!!!) so I asked for another page to sign on as I am a very junior member.
The thing I have committed to is the autopilot bolt on to the Monitor wind vane. This is a new development by Scanmar and it looks really good. Scanmar have just pulled another rabbit out of the hat which converts the vane paddle into an auxiliary rudder a la Hydrovane.
The talk by Tony Curphey was outstanding. Duncan Wells also good but we already knew that! I am going to nick lots of Tony Curphey’s arrangements.
